What is SDR in ham radio?
SDR is an acronym for Software Defined Radio. It refers to a radio that is controlled entirely by software. This includes the tuning, the filters, and the demodulation. The actual hardware required is minimal, and this has allowed SDR to become very popular in the ham radio community.
There are many advantages to using SDR. One of the biggest is that it can be used to emulate other radios. This means that you can use a computer to simulate a very expensive radio. This can be a great way to learn about radios that you may never be able to afford.
SDR also allows you to experiment with new modes and bands that you may never have tried before. With a traditional radio, you are limited by the hardware that is available. With SDR, you can simply download new software and try out a new mode.
SDR is also very flexible. You can use it for voice, data, or image transmission. You can also use it to build radios that are not possible with traditional hardware.
There are some disadvantages to SDR. One is that it can be difficult to get good performance from a small computer. Another is that it can be difficult to find software that does what you want.

How do I listen to ham RTL-SDR?
If you’re interested in listening to ham radio using an RTL-SDR, there are a few things you need to know. In this article, we will cover the basics of how to get started listening to ham radio with an RTL-SDR.
The first thing you need is an RTL-SDR. This is a low-cost, software-defined radio that can be used to listen to a variety of signals, including ham radio. You can buy an RTL-SDR from a variety of sources, such as eBay, Amazon, or directly from the RTL-SDR website.
The next thing you need is a program that can decode the signals that you are interested in. There are a number of programs that can do this, such as SDR#, HDSDR, and GQRX. Each of these programs has its own strengths and weaknesses, so you may need to try a few of them to see which one works best for you.
Once you have an RTL-SDR and a program that can decode signals, the next step is to find a frequency to listen to. This can be done by using a program such as waterfall, which can show you the frequencies that are being used in a particular area. You can then tune your RTL-SDR to one of these frequencies and start listening.

What does an SDR dongle do?
An SDR dongle is a device that allows users to access and analyze signals from various radio frequency sources. This can include signals from wireless communications, broadcasting, radar and navigation systems, and many other sources. SDR dongles are often used by hobbyists, scientists, and students to learn about and experiment with radio frequency signals.
SDR dongles work by converting radio frequency signals into digital data that can be processed by a computer. This allows users to view, record, and analyze signals that would be otherwise difficult or impossible to see or hear. SDR dongles can be used with a variety of software applications that allow for a wide range of uses.
Some common applications that can be used with SDR dongles include spectrum analyzers, signal generators, and demodulators. These applications can be used to view and analyze the characteristics of signals, test electronic equipment, and decode communications signals.
SDR dongles are a powerful tool for learning about and experimenting with radio frequency signals. They can be used by hobbyists, students, and professionals to access and analyze signals from a wide range of sources.
